More than 33,000 premises will now receive an internet connection boost in Tasmania, with three Hobart suburbs leading the way in the most available upgrades.

The Australian Government has invested around $2.4b as part of an election commitment to expand full-fibre access to a further 1.5 million homes and businesses across Australia, including 660,000 in regional areas.

Part of this funding will support the implementation of Australia’s broadband network NBN to 33,000 properties, that can start making the switch to internet that is 18 times faster than the average copper broadband connection.

Fibre networks also provide families with a more reliable connection that can end up saving money when compared to other internet plans on average.

Of the 33,000 homes that can start making the switch, Howrah, Sandy Bay, Longford, Devonport and Rokeby have the highest number of available upgrades.

Federal Minister for Communications Michelle Rowland said the government is committed to getting more Australians access to better, faster broadband.

“Our strong investment ensures more and more households have access to this technology – unlocking greater social inclusion and economic productivity through faster, more reliable internet,” she said.

“I look forward to more families and businesses across Tasmania and the country benefiting from this higher speed option.”

The government has also invested a further $480m in NBN Fixed Wireless and NBN Sky Muster networks to boost internet speeds in rural and regional areas.
